BMS Digital Safety Best Practices for Modern Buildings
Ensuring comprehensive digital safety within automated systems is critical for modern building operations . A layered strategy to security should be adopted , encompassing various key aspects. These include frequent security audits to identify potential threats. Furthermore, strict access controls are necessary , limiting system usage to permitted personnel only. Network partitioning should be used to contain any intrusions . Finally, ongoing monitoring and prompt remediation to warnings are fundamental components of a successful BMS digital safety initiative .
- Perform frequent security audits .
- Utilize strict access permissions .
- Implement network segmentation .
- Provide continuous tracking.

Securing Your BMS: A Comprehensive Digital Safety Checklist
Protecting your facility management system (BMS) is essential in today's digital landscape . This checklist provides a thorough overview of steps to improve your digital protection . Start by examining your current network setup, including protection configurations and user authorizations. Implement robust password procedures and consistently patch both the BMS platform and integrated devices. Don't overlook the importance of employee training on cybersecurity awareness and threat management . Finally, carry out periodic vulnerability scans to detect and resolve potential vulnerabilities before they can be exploited by malicious actors.
